They are open quite early for Yum Cha, so it is best to go earlier than at 12pm. Usually there is a bit of a wait, as the restaurant is not big. Most tables are suitable for 4 people, with a few that can sit more. They bring out the food on trays, instead of trolleys and the selection is limited to your more traditional dishes. Still very tasty, but no special dishes

A pretty nice yumcha place with reasonable prices. We went on a public holiday, it was busy but no wait time, we were seated immediately.
Everything was good, nothing incredible but was overall tasty. The highlight would be the steamed yellow cake rolls, not too sweet, very fluffy with a little bit of saltiness from the filling in the centre.
The bathroom was not very well maintained though. It wasn't disgusting, but only half of the toilets and basins were working, the others just had tape around them.
Was about $130 for four adults, which I found ok, considering it was a public holiday.
Good place to eat with friends. Just don't all go to the bathroom at once.
